As a consumer, you can drive the market for sustainable seafood by choosing fish only from healthy, responsibly-managed sources, and caught or farmed in ways which minimize damage to the marine environment. What is sustainable seafood was my first thought after hearing about this? What that means is the fishing is managed for protection against overfishing, habitat damage, and pollution and doesn’t compromise the surrounding ecosystem.
